The 2018 Kuo Symposium/Workshop on 3DEM of Cells and Molecules, which will be held at Zhejiang University, Hangzhou, China. Major topics of the Symposium include recent developments in cryoEM sample preparation and data acquisition, advances in cryoEM image analysis and reconstruction, advances in cryoET and in situ structural biology, and correlative and hybrid methods for cellular structural analysis.
The cryoEM meeting and workshop series is named after K.H. Kuo (1923-2006), a prominent Chinese scientist, who is among the pioneers discovered several types of quasicrystals in 1980s. Dr. Kuo was also an important educator and mentor who had fostered a generation of electron microscopists in China, Asia and across the world. Since 2008, the Kuo summer school of electron microscopy has provided numerous opportunities for a new generation of scientists to learn the technique of cryoEM through close interactions with many leading scientists in the field during workshop and symposium.
